Key Responsibilities

  • Develop, test, and maintain backend software components and services that integrate with blockchain networks and digital asset infrastructure.
  • Implement blockchain integrations — including node connectivity, transaction submission, on‑chain event monitoring, and wallet interactions — using enterprise Java and Web3 libraries.
  • Write, test, and deploy smart contracts in Solidity or equivalent languages, following established security and quality standards.
  • Build and maintain APIs and microservices that expose blockchain functionality to upstream platform consumers and business applications.
  • Implement asynchronous and event‑driven processing to manage transaction lifecycle, on‑chain state changes, and blockchain data synchronization.
  • Participate actively in code reviews, contributing constructive feedback and maintaining high standards of code quality, readability, and test coverage.
  • Collaborate with architects, senior engineers, and product teams to understand requirements and translate them into well‑structured, maintainable software solutions.
  • Contribute to technical documentation including component design notes, API specifications, and integration guides.
  • Support debugging, troubleshooting, and resolution of issues across the blockchain software stack in development and production environments.
  • Follow and contribute to engineering best practices, coding standards, and Agile delivery processes within the team.
  • Stay informed of developments in the blockchain and Web3 ecosystem, including protocol updates, new tooling, and emerging standards relevant to the platform.
  • Participate in sprint ceremonies — planning, stand‑ups, reviews, and retrospectives — as part of an Agile/Scrum delivery team.

Competencies/Skills

  • Blockchain Development Proficiency: Practical, hands‑on ability to develop software that interacts with blockchain networks — from smart contract deployment to on‑chain/off‑chain data integration.
  • Strong Software Engineering Fundamentals: Solid command of data structures, algorithms, design patterns, and software development best practices, with the ability to write clean, testable, and maintainable code.
  • Security Awareness: Understanding of common smart contract vulnerabilities and secure coding practices relevant to on‑chain deployments in a regulated environment.
  • Collaborative Team Player: Works effectively within a distributed, cross‑functional team; communicates clearly and proactively with peers, leads, and stakeholders.
  • Attention to Detail: Rigorous and methodical approach to testing, code quality, and documentation — especially critical given the immutable nature of blockchain deployments.
  • Curiosity & Learning Agility: Genuine interest in blockchain and Web3 technologies, with the drive to continuously learn and apply new tools, protocols, and patterns.
  • Delivery Commitment: Reliable and accountable in managing personal workstreams, meeting sprint commitments, and producing quality output within agreed timelines.
  • Tooling Familiarity: Working knowledge of standard engineering tools including Git, Jira, Jenkins, Docker, Hardhat/Foundry, and relevant observability platforms.
